Transaction dd48254886b15f3d3f3757a2916fc4d40a73401a321498c604536279b3704a7a
1 Input
1 Output
-
dd48254886b15f3d3f3757a2916fc4d40a73401a321498c604536279b3704a7a:0
- value
- 18697
- script pubkey
- OP_0 OP_PUSHBYTES_20 3fcb23105022725f5852b3e6d416ae1b17994f76
- address
- bc1q8l9jxyzsyfe97kzjk0ndg94wrvtejnmkwdmr9f